The authors report on a workstation that delivers the Infrared Atmospherics and Signatures Prediction Model (IASPM) hosted on a transportable unit, giving a rich assortment of tabular and 2-D/3-D graphical soft-copy/hard-copy outputs. Originally geared to support IRSTS planners and analysts, IASPM has broader applications as a common reference and tool for electro-optical sensor developers, vehicle signature experts, propulsion signature experts, vehicle designers, and weapons system planners. It provides a means of disseminating this information in a practicable form to avionics designers, specifiers, buyers, suppliers, operators, maintainers, strategists and tacticians. The features of IASPM described in detail include the Spectral IR Imaging of Targets and Scenes (SPIRITS) target model, SPIRITS databases, SPIRITS geometric modeling, exhaust plume modeling, background scenes, atmospheric models, the sensor model, expert features, and input/output features.
